Zayn Malik inspired by 'fearless' Prince

Darpan News Desk IANS, 16 Jun, 2016 11:33 AM
    Singer Zayn Malik says he is inspired to be "fearless" by the late pop icon Prince.
     
    The former One Direction star is "really upset" that the "Purple rain" hitmaker passed away in April this year at the age of 57, but is hopeful his legacy will continue on, reports femalefirst.co.uk.
     
    "It was obviously a surprise, I think for everybody. A lot of starting references for me are technology and Prince. I'm conscious in the back of my head of how he was sort of bold and fearless in the way he decided to dress," Malik told Dazed magazine. 
     
    The "Pillowtalk" hitmaker said that Prince "created another world" with the clothes he wore, which gave him an "otherworldly feel". 
     
    "I was really upset with the fact that he passed away. But it is nice that we can use things now to portray what inspired us about him. That was kind of what I was doing at the Met Ball (an annual fundraising gala for the benefit of the Metropolitan Museum of Art's Costume Institute in New York City)... Being fearless. But I was just having fun," the 23-year-old singer said.
